North of Dinosaur CR16 - Dispersed Site

Campers find themselves largely alone at this dispersed site accessed via County Road 16, where rocky terrain and lack of shade define the camping experience. The dirt road extends roughly 10 miles to reach the sites, with some uphill sections requiring 4WD capability according to visitors. Two primary spots maintain adequate spacing between campers, each featuring established fire rings.

The elevated position provides southerly views across the landscape, though wind can be a persistent factor. "Really nice and quiet, we were all alone," notes Anika T. about the site's isolation. Additional camping spots extend further down CR16 past the main GPS waypoint, including sites tucked back along grassy double tracks visible from the initial pull-off area.

Despite sitting just off the county road, traffic noise remains minimal. Cell coverage varies by carrier, with T-Mobile users reporting low to mid-range signal strength. Campers should prepare for exposed conditions and bring adequate water, as the rocky ground and lack of natural windbreaks make this better suited for those comfortable with primitive camping conditions.

Reviewed Aug. 6, 2023

Scenic Views

This location as more camping spots available down CR16 past the GPS waypoint. The site at the waypoint has 2-3 more sites tucked back down the grassy double track you can see from the initial pull-off. Great views from any site, if windy.
